The melee with the Badgers occurred following a street loss on Feb. 20, 2022.
Wisconsin head coach Greg Gard known as a timeout with 15 seconds left in regulation and his crew up by 15 factors, apparently resulting in Howard’s frustration.
The previous longtime NBA huge man acquired concerned in a heated change with Gard within the postgame handshake line. As assistant coaches and gamers tried to separate the 2, Howard swiped at Badgers assistant Joe Krabbenhoft.
Howard was banned for the remainder of the common season and fined $40,000, whereas Michigan forwards Terrance Williams II and Moussa Diabate have been suspended for one sport. Gard was handed a $10,000 tremendous, and Wisconsin guard Jahcobi Neath was suspended one sport.
Howard defended his actions following the brawl however struck a noticeably completely different tone in his chat with Quinn.
